Algorithms and tools for high-throughput geometry-based analysis of crystalline porous materials

[Display omitted] ► We present algorithms for analysis of the void space in porous materials. ► Calculation of the diameters of the largest included and largest free spherical probes. ► Determination of accessibility of void space and dimensionality of channel systems. ► Algorithms for Monte Carlo i...
